引言
TPWallet 中的 gas 不只是费用参数,而是链上交易成功与否、速度与成本之间的平衡器。理解并合理设置 gas,能提升资金流通效率、兼容不同共识机制、支持便捷支付场景并降低安全风险。本文围绕高效资金流通、工作量证明的影响、便捷支付应用、创新科技发展、全球化智能平台建设和溢出漏洞防护给出系统性解释与建议。

一 高效资金流通
1) 动态费率与路由:利用实时费率估算器根据链上拥堵调整 gas price 或 base fee,避免因过高费用造成成本浪费或因过低被长时间卡在池中。2) Gas 限额设置:设置略高于预估值的 gas limit 以防合约调用中途失败,但避免无限制提升以致手续费飙升。3) 批量与合并交易:对可合并的转账或操作做批处理,降低总体 gas 消耗,提升资金流通效率。
二 工作量证明(PoW)对 Gas 的影响
PoW 链通常存在出块不稳定、拥堵突发的特性,导致手续费波动较大。PoW 环境下:1) 优先考虑快速确认的交易需提高 gas price;2) 在低拥堵窗口发送大额或重要交易;3) 通过交易替换(Replace-By-Fee)或重发策略管理被卡交易。

此外理解不同共识机制(PoW、PoS、L2)的费率模型有助于跨链场景下合理设置 gas。
三 便捷支付应用的实现路径
1) Gas 抽象与代付:使用 meta-transaction、relayer 或 ERC-4337 等方案实现用户免 gas 或由商户/第三方代付,提高用户体验。2) 离线与链下确认:在小额高频支付场景采用链下渠道(如 state channels)合并链上结算,降低用户感知的手续费与延迟。3) UX 优化:在 TPWallet 中展示预估时延、费用区间与可选策略(经济、平衡、快速),让用户按场景选择。
四 创新型科技发展方向
1) Layer2 与 Rollup:集成多种 Layer2 方案,自动选择最经济路径并在必要时回退至主链。2) zk 与隐私技术:在保护隐私的同时优化 gas 使用。3) AI 驱动的费用预测:通过机器学习模型预测短期拥堵与最优上链时机,自动化调节发送时机与费用。
五 全球化智能平台构建要点
1) 跨链网关与费率统一:建立多链费率聚合器,提供统一的估费界面与转账策略。2) 区域化节点与合规配置:在全球部署可靠 RPC 节点并考虑地域合规与支付惯例差异。3) 生态互操作:支持不同代币、桥接机制与本地支付对接,提升资金全球流通能力。
六 溢出漏洞与安全防护
1) 溢出类型:智能合约中常见整数溢出/下溢会影响金额与手续费计算;钱包原生代码也可能存在缓冲区溢出等内存漏洞。2) 风险场景:错误的 gas 计算或乘法/加法未检查导致手续费或余额错误,攻击者可利用重入或精度问题触发损失。3) 防护措施:
- 在合约中使用安全数学库(SafeMath 或编译器内置检查)并限制输入范围。
- 对所有外部调用使用重入锁、checks-effects-interactions 模式。
- 钱包端对 RPC 响应、数值边界与小数精度进行严格校验,避免浮点误差。4) 测试与审计:结合模糊测试、符号执行、静态分析和第三方审计,模拟极值与并发场景验证 gas 计算与转账逻辑的稳健性。
七 实践建议总结
1) 对普通用户:使用钱包提供的费率推荐,必要时选择“快速”或“经济”策略;遇到长时间未确认的交易,谨慎使用替换或取消。2) 对开发者/商户:实现代付与 meta-tx、在合约中防护溢出、采用 Layer2 以降低成本并提供分层回退策略。3) 对平台运营方:构建多源费率聚合器、AI 预测模型与全球化节点布局,持续进行代码审计与安全演练。
结语
在 TPWallet 中合理设置 gas 并结合代付、Layer2、AI 预测与严格的安全工程,可在提升资金流通效率与用户体验的同时,降低因工作量证明链特性和溢出漏洞带来的风险。面向未来,创新技术与全球化平台将进一步推动支付场景的便捷性与安全性。
评论
CryptoCat
对代付和 meta-transaction 的讲解很实用,期待更多 Layer2 实例分析。
张小白
溢出漏洞那部分写得很详细,合约开发者必须关注。
BlockchainBob
关于 PoW 费用波动的建议很接地气,尤其是替换策略那段。
未来行者
AI 预测费率和全球节点部署的结合,想知道有哪些现成开源工具可用?
Luna
文章兼顾用户与开发者视角,适合钱包产品经理阅读。